Common Injuries from Improper Guidebook Handling

When workers engage in improper hands-on handling methods, they might suffer from:

    Back Stress: The most common injury associated with hand-operated handling. Neck Discomfort: Commonly caused by raising heavy lots incorrectly. Shoulder Injuries: Resulting from repetitive overhanging lifting. Knee Injuries: Specifically prevalent in building and construction or storage facility settings.

Recognizing these possible threats stresses the requirement of proper training and awareness.

Manual Handling Strategies for Safe Practice

The Basics of Correct Lifting Techniques

Assess the Tons: Prior to lifting any type of object, review its weight and size. Position Your Feet: Stand shoulder-width apart for far better balance. Bend Your Knees: Maintain your back directly while bending your knees for leverage. Grip Strongly: Guarantee you have an excellent grasp on the things prior to raising it. Lift with Your Legs: Utilize your leg muscular tissues as opposed to your when lifting. Keep the Tons Close: Hold things close to your body while relocating them. Avoid Twisting: Move your feet rather than turning your torso while carrying loads.

These basic methods considerably decrease the probability of crashes and injuries associated with inappropriate manual handling.
